### "Enough" qanday ishlatiladi?

Adjective + enough
✔️ This bag is light enough. (Bu sumka yetarlicha yengil.)
✔️ He is old enough to drive. (U haydash uchun yetarlicha katta.)

Enough + noun
✔️ I have enough money. (Menda yetarlicha pul bor.)
✔️ We don’t have enough time. (Bizda yetarlicha vaqt yo‘q.)

Enough good ❌ noto‘g‘ri!

Qoida:
🔹 *Enough* sifat oldidan emas, keyin keladi.
🔹 *Enough* ot oldidan keladi.

"Despite" vs. "Although" – Qaysi biri?

Despite + noun / gerund (-ing)
✔️ Despite the rain, we went outside.
✔️ Despite being tired, he kept working.

Although + subject + verb
✔️ Although it was raining, we went outside.
✔️ Although he was tired, he kept working.

Despite it was raining – ❌ noto‘g‘ri!
Although the rain – ❌ noto‘g‘ri!

Qoida:
🔹 *Despite* – ortidan gap emas, noun yoki gerund keladi.
🔹 *Although* – ortidan subject + verb keladi.

He is worth or he worths?

To'g'ri variant: "He is worth"

"Worth" fe'l emas, balki sifatdir, shuning uchun oldiga "is" qo'shiladi.

He is worth it. (U bunga arziydi.)
This book is worth reading. (Bu kitobni o‘qishga arziydi.)

He worths — noto‘g‘ri, chunki "worth" hech qachon fe'l shaklida ishlatilmaydi.

🔰 FIVE ALTERNATIVES TO 'IMPORTANT'

🔘 CRUCIAL
It is crucial that we meet the deadline.

🔘 ESSENTIAL
Water is essential for human survival.

🔘 SIGNIFICANT
The discovery was a significant breakthrough in medicine.

🔘 VITAL
Regular exercise plays a vital role in staying healthy.

🔘 KEY
Confidence is the key to success.

🔰FIVE ALTERNATIVES TO 'WRONG'

🔘INACCURATE
The sales figures were inaccurate. Why?

🔘INCORRECT
If more than 50 per cent of your answers are incorrect, you will fail the test.

🔘UNTRUE
The police believe your account of what happened last night is untrue.

🔘FALSE
If you give false information, you could go to jail.

🔘NOT RIGHT
These directions are not right. We're lost!
